Steps
-
Clean the chicken wings and drain them. A small piece of ginger and an appropriate amount of chives.
-
Put the chicken wings in a bowl and add appropriate amount of rice wine. Cut the ginger into shreds and put the chives in a bowl, add an appropriate amount of salt, mix well and marinate for fifteen minutes.
-
Heat a pan, add appropriate amount of salad oil, and fry the chicken wings in the pan.
-
Put the seasonings in the ingredient list into a bowl, mix into a bowl of juice and set aside.
-
Fry one side of the chicken wings until golden brown, then flip to the other side.
-
When both sides of the chicken wings are golden brown, add the bowl of juice and cook over low heat for about ten minutes.
-
Turn off the heat when the soup in the pot becomes thick.
